Skip to content

Latest commit

 

History

History
51 lines (29 loc) · 1.45 KB

README.md

File metadata and controls

51 lines (29 loc) · 1.45 KB

DevDay2019-Performance-Tuning

DevDay2019 for Performance Tuning

Kick up and run

1. Run with default setting (local DB, default ports)

mvn clean spring-boot:run

2. Run with external properties file

mvn spring-boot:run -Dspring.config.location="your_application.properties"

3. Init data on local

mvn clean spring-boot:run -PinitData

4. Init data on server

mvn spring-boot:run -Dspring.config.location="profiles/groupX_application.properties" -Dspring-boot.run.arguments="--spring.datasource.initialize=true,--spring.datasource.initialization-mode=always"

Or

java -jar devday2019project-0.0.1-SNAPSHOT.jar --spring.config.location=profiles/groupX_application.properties --spring.datasource.initialize=true --spring.datasource.initialization-mode=always 

5. DevOps

Build .jar

mvn clean install

Copy .jar file to server

Run on server with specific profile

java -jar devday2019project-0.0.1-SNAPSHOT.jar --spring.config.location=groupX_application.properties

X: is your group number

6. Swagger

http://host:port/swagger-ui.html#/

DevOps: Please ask your supporter for team's properties files

Book external source